With its beautifully marked body and powerful appearance, this species makes a spectacular centrepiece for larger aquariums.\u003c\/span\u003e\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p class=\"isSelectedEnd\"\u003e\u003cspan\u003eNative to fast-flowing rivers in South America, the Leopard Cactus Pleco thrives in aquariums with excellent water quality, strong filtration, and plenty of oxygenation. Provide driftwood, rocks, and caves to create secure hiding places, as this species enjoys establishing its own territory.\u003c\/span\u003e\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p class=\"isSelectedEnd\"\u003e\u003cspan\u003eWhile generally peaceful with similarly sized fish, mature males can become territorial towards other bottom-dwelling plecos, particularly in smaller aquariums. They are best housed with medium to large community fish or South American cichlids in spacious aquariums.\u003c\/span\u003e\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003ch3\u003e\u003cspan\u003eFeeding\u003c\/span\u003e\u003c\/h3\u003e\n\u003cp class=\"isSelectedEnd\"\u003e\u003cspan\u003eLeopard Cactus Plecos are omnivores with a preference for meaty foods. Offer a varied diet of high-quality sinking carnivore pellets, algae wafers, frozen bloodworms, mussels, prawns, krill, and other protein-rich foods.
